Job Summary (Data Warehouse Program Manager):

- Lead the implementation of data accessibility strategies for enterprise cloud migration programs.
- Manage large-scale data migrations from mainframe (DB2) and open systems (Oracle SQL Server) to cloud platforms.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ure effective ETL processes and unified data warehouse integration.
- Guide data curation transformation and quality initiatives to provide high-value consumable data assets.
- Ensure compliance with data governance privacy and regulatory standards in multi-customer environments.
- Work closely with data architects and engineers utilizing knowledge of relational databases and data modeling.
- Align program execution with business objectives emphasizing data integrity security and accessibility.
- Operate within agile environments managing stakeholder priorities and project timelines.
- Leverage familiarity with AWS data services (S3 Redshift Glue RDS) and modern cloud data architecture.
- Communicate technical trade-offs and design decisions effectively with both business and technical stakeholders.
